Output 34e672a99a00bccbe94c8c7586717055094756604245035796a2ea5d331ed202:1

value
485568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2e27260c60694f5457df151066bb7f184aba2ee OP_EQUALVERIFY OP_CHECKSIG
address
1JmTN1oa1NSmMWjmnYEt4zp2avoHYmPUa2
transaction
34e672a99a00bccbe94c8c7586717055094756604245035796a2ea5d331ed202
spent
true